What is an audio engineer part time?
A Part-Time Audio Engineer is responsible for recording, editing, and mixing sound for various media, such as music, film, live events, or podcasts, on a limited-hour basis. They set up and operate audio equipment, ensure sound quality, and troubleshoot technical issues. This role is ideal for freelancers, students, or professionals seeking flexible work in the audio industry. Hours vary depending on project needs, and work may be done on-site or remotely.
What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the audio engineer part time position?
To thrive as a Part-Time Audio Engineer, you need strong knowledge of audio recording, mixing, and editing, often supported by experience or a degree in audio production or a related field. Familiarity with digital audio workstations (DAWs) like Pro Tools, Logic Pro, or Ableton Live, as well as microphones, soundboards, and signal processing equipment, is crucial. Att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ication greatly enhance performance in a collaborative environment. These skills ensure high-quality sound output, adaptability in fast-paced settings, and successful teamwork with artists and technical staff.
What are the typical work hours and environments for a part-time audio engineer?
Part-time audio engineers often work flexible hours, which may include evenings or weekends depending on event schedules or studio bookings. The work environment can range from live event venues and recording studios to broadcast stations or remote setups for podcasts and online streaming. You might collaborate with musicians, producers, or technical teams, so adaptability and teamwork are important. Shifts may vary week to week, but most employers provide schedules in advance, allowing good balance with other personal or professional commitments. This flexibility also offers valuable experience managing real-world projects across different audio settings.

Job Title: Audacy Rochester Fall Internship
Department: Programming
Reporting To: Brand Manager
Employment Type: Part Time
Work Arrangement: On-site
Job Description:
We are offering a Fall Internship Program for our Rochester NY Brands: 92.5 WBEE, 98 PXY, 96.5 WCMF, 9.89 The Buzz, and WGR Rochester.
The Opportunity:
- 9 week fall internship
- Interns will be expected to work 3 days a week with up to 20 hours per week
-Relocation is not provided, you will be expected to be able to commute into the Rochester office
Our internships are paid opportunities with a competitive hourly wage. School credit is not required; however, we will provide the necessary documentation for school credit if desired.
The anticipated starting salary range for New York-based individuals expressing interest in this position is $16.00/Hr..
Salary to be determined by the education, experience, knowledge, skills, abilities and location of the applicant, as well as internal and external equity.
ResponsibilitiesWhat You'll Do:
What You'll Do May Include (but is not limited to):
- Experience first-hand and directly contribute to the operations of Rochester's premiere sports and entertainment organizations
- Observing and assisting live programming
- Learn the inner workings of broadcast, digital and live events
- Pre-show prep, writing, production, rehearsal and content treatment aligning daily content to brand goals
- Gathering audio and video for each day's program
- Screening of live phone calls and text message exchanges
- Post show production, including editing of audio and podcast distribution
- Voiceover assignments and commercial production as needed
- Video stream management, editing and clipping
- Social media and website contribution
- Music selection and scheduling
- Assist in any station appearances or live broadcasts
- Video or assist in editing show/talent video shorts for social media and client endorsements
- Support the marketing, sales, and programming teams in performing daily office functions as part of each department's business strategy
- Work as a team while collaborating with other departments to gather and arrange information needed for various projects and brainstorm ideas
- Attend meetings and training sessions
Required & Preferred:
Internship Eligibility Requirements:
- Must be actively enrolled in a U.S. accredited college or university degree
- Must be a resident of New York State and/or attending school in New York State
- Must be a college junior and senior
- Must be 18 years or older
- Proper authorization needed to be employed within the United States
- Must be a first time entrant into the New York State Broadcasters Association internship program
- Must be able to work 3 days/up to 20 hours a week (5a-12n or 2p-6p)
- College Credit is not required, but can be provided upon request if needed
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ills
- Strong multi-tasking, organizational, and time management skills
- Ability to excel in a team environment, yet resourceful and self-motivated
